> > it looks like cyrus imapd has not been ported to gcc 3.3 sofar. > > Can you be more specific ? When trying to build imapd you get In file included from com_err.c:54: /kolab/lib/gcc-lib/i686-pc-linux-gnu/3.3/include/varargs.h:4:2: #error "GCC no longer implements <varargs.h>." /kolab/lib/gcc-lib/i686-pc-linux-gnu/3.3/include/varargs.h:5:2: #error "Revise your code to use <stdarg.h>." com_err.c:88: error: parse error before "va_list" com_err.c: In function `default_com_err_proc': com_err.c:100: error: `whoami' undeclared (first use in this function) with gcc-3.3 -- -- martin Dipl.-Phys.
